Chandler Chamber of Commerce Endorses Salmon for Congress

 

June 26, 2012
Salmon for Congress

EAST VALLEY - Matt Salmon, former Congressman and candidate for Arizona's 5th congressional district, today received the endorsement from the Chandler Chamber of Commerce, a leading advocate for businesses in the East Valley. After an extensive endorsement process with the Chamber's Good Government Committee and a candidate forum, Salmon earned the endorsement over his Republican and Democrat opponents.

"It is a great honor to receive the support from the Chandler Chamber of Commerce," stated former Congressman Salmon. "Chandler is a major hub for economic development in the East Valley and I look forward to working with Chandler business leaders to promote policies that will foster growth. I have heard loud and clear from the business community in Chandler that we need to reduce regulation, end oppressive tax policies and repeal Obamacare. I intend to return to Congress and accomplish tasks so we can get our economy back on track across the East Valley and Arizona."

Earlier this morning, Salmon received the endorsement of the Small Business Alliance, another East Valley organization that advocates for pro-business and pro-growth policies. Salmon has now been endorsed by an assortment of Arizona business groups, including the Arizona Hospital and Healthcare Association, the Arizona Auto Dealers Association, the Associated General Contractors, the Arizona Farm Bureau and the Arizona Association of Realtors.

About the Chandler Chamber of Commerce
The Chandler Chamber of Commerce is a membership organization serving the business community of Chandler, AZ and the East Valley. For over 75 years, the Chandler Chamber has been an advocate for pro-business policies and has worked with hundreds of companies in Chandler and across the East Valley towards building a better business environment in their community.

About Matt Salmon
Matt Salmon was first elected to the United States Congress in 1994 and served until 2000, honoring his term limit pledge. A proud conservative, Salmon was rated in the top five among all 535 members of the House and Senate by Citizen's Against Government Waste for all six years he was in office. He is a lifetime member of the NRA with an A+ rating and also earned a 100% rating by the National Right to Life. He was also the proud recipient of the American Cancer Society's "Top National Elected Official" award.

Matt Salmon has received endorsements from Arizona Congressmen Trent Franks and David Schweikert, former Arizona Congressman John Shadegg, Maricopa County Sheriff Joe Arpaio, Mayors Scott Smith (Mesa), Jay Tibshraeny (Chandler), Hugh Hallman (Tempe), John Insalaco (Apache Junction) and Gail Barney (Queen Creek), fourteen (14) Arizona state senators and fifteen (15) Arizona state representatives. Salmon has also been endorsed by South Dakota Senator John Thune, Oklahoma Senator Tom Coburn, Pennsylvania Senator Pat Toomey, Utah Senator Mike Lee, Congressman Darrell Issa (CA-49), and former Florida Governor Jeb Bush.
